2009 Hyundai i30 vs. 1981 Mini MK IV

To start off, 2009 Hyundai i30 is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Mini MK IV.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Mini MK IV would be higher. At 1,590 cc (4 cylinders), 2009 Hyundai i30 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Hyundai i30 (124 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 90 more horse power than 1981 Mini MK IV. (34 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Hyundai i30 should accelerate faster than 1981 Mini MK IV.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Hyundai i30 weights approximately 604 kg more than 1981 Mini MK IV.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Hyundai i30 (154 Nm @ 5200 RPM) has 93 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Mini MK IV. (61 Nm @ 2900 RPM). This means 2009 Hyundai i30 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Mini MK IV.
